The dog side eye is a common behavior exhibited by canines when they are feeling uncertain, uncomfortable, or threatened. It is characterized by a sideways glance or sideways tilt of the head, and is often accompanied by other body language cues such as raised eyebrows, flared nostrils, or a tense posture.

The dog side eye, also called "whale eye" or "half-moon eye," occurs when a dog turns its head away while keeping its eyes fixated on a person, object, or situation. This results in the whites of the dog's eyes, or sclera, becoming more apparent, giving the impression of a sideways glance.

The sclera, or whites of the dog's eyes, will look like a half-moon, usually positioned at the outer or inner side of the eye but occasionally around the entire eye. Also referred to as "half-moon eye" or dog side-eye, whale eye is an important indicator of canine behavior and should be carefully observed by owners and trainers alike.
